> >> > Heard Harsha interviewed by Rick Cluff on CBC about 8:15 this morning.
> >> > She
> >> > was great! In a very few minutes, she cut through all the BS about
> >> the
> >> > missing women inquiry. Basically, what I got from it: 1) the inquiry
> >> has
> >> > turned into police lawyering up and protecting their own butts - this
> >> has
> >> > made it into an adversarial process, 2) there are women living on the
> >> DTES
> >> > still today who knew what happened on the Pickton farm and the police
> >> > didn't
> >> > want to hear it then and apparently don't want it to come out now, 3)
> >> the
> >> > inquiry was structured to be adversarial - if the police didn't have
> >> > lawyers, the women who could testify wouldn't be requiring lawyers
> >> either
> >> > -
> >> > as it is, the police lawyers would eat these vulnerable witnesses
> >> alive,
> >> > 4)
> >> > these women who have real information about what happened on the
> >> ground
> >> > need
> >> > to be treated as part of the category of "victims and their families"
> >> who
> >> > are being provided legal counsel by the province, 5) what kind of
> >> > protection
> >> > will the women have afterwards if they testify?, 6) the women and
> >> their
> >> > organizations are the ones who've been working for decades to get this
> >> > inquiry - they are the most committed of all to having it, and the
> >> fact
> >> > that
> >> > they are being marginalized and can't safely testify is destroying the
> >> > potential of the inquiry. Cluff dragged out everything the government
> >> and
> >> > the other press have been saying and she demolished it.
